Cloud security is a growing concern for businesses and individuals who use cloud-based services. The cloud offers many benefits, including flexibility, scalability, and cost savings. However, the cloud also introduces new risks that must be managed.

Organizations need to consider both the advantages and disadvantages of using the cloud before deciding whether it is right for them. Those who do decide to use the cloud should take steps to ensure their data is secure. This includes encrypting data in transit and at rest, as well as implementing robust access control measures.

Individuals also need to be aware of the risks associated with using cloud-based services. When choosing a service provider, make sure to research their security practices and policies. Be sure to only store sensitive information in the cloud if it is absolutely necessary.
